Swot Analysis for Sainsbury's
It is the strategic framework which can help the firm to evaluate different potential
factors which could affect their performance in the market. There are different components in
this model which is mentioned below:
Strengths – This factors helps the company to become more productive in every manner
by capitalising on their strengths. In relation to Sainsbury's the organisation provide the
products as per customer demands. This helps them to attain maximum customer
satisfaction in the market. The company also has improved social presence. Through this
they are able to create a positive brand value in the market.
Weakness – The company needs to improve different aspects in order to perform better
in the industry. In relevance to Sainsbury's they are expensive for the customers. The
main issue which they are facing is that the products does nit have the good life
(Karpenko, and et.al 2019). On the other hand, the company is also facing the financial
instability in the industry which affects their brand value in a negative manner.
Opportunities – This is one of the most crucial components which helps the company to
capitalise on different opportunities. Sainsbury can implement different technological
advancements to improve their online presence in the market. The company can also

provide the 24 X 7 services which will help them to improve their brand integrity in the
market.
Threats – The organisation needs to minimise the effects of the threats which is present
in the marker. They need to implement different strategies and approaches in an effective
manner. In relation to Sainsbury's the major threat for them is the increasing competition
in the retail industry (Manasakis, 2018). There are certain rules and regulations which
they are facing while expanding their business in new regions.
Pestle Analysis
Pestle analysis helps the firm to become more effective in carrying out the operations by
understanding the market conditions. There are different factor of this tool which is described
below:
Political Factor – This are multiple political factors which could affect the company
performance. In relation to Sainsbury's there are different laws which is established in the
region, It includes the Brexit uncertainties this has affected the performance of the
company. There is a heavy duty which the organisation has to pay on the export and
import of the products.
Economic Factor – The organisation needs to fulfil different economical factors in an
significant manner. In relation to Sainsbury's the main concern is the rising salaries of the
employees which needs to be concerned properly. This is affecting the company growth
in the market.
Social Factor – There are multiple socio cultural factors which is affecting Sainsbury's.
It includes the fair trade movement and other etc. Sainsbury's has been following the
health and safety regulations. This helps them to maintain a positive brand image in the
market
Technological Factor – There are different technological advancements which can help
the company to achieve greater performance in the market (Su, and Tan, 2018).
Sainsbury's can introduce the online shopping to the customers which will help them to
incur more profits. They are able to achieve greater results in the future.
Legal Factor – These are the factors which is been emerging with the changing
environment. It includes employment laws, health and safety laws etc. Sainsbury's is able
to fulfil all the laws by establishing a systematic structure in the workplace. The

management works in an effective way to achieve different gaols and objectives in the
market.
Environmental Factor – The organisation needs to follow different corporate strategies
in order to preserve the environment. Sainsbury's is been focusing on different factors to
reduce the waste. They are also able to utilise the resources in an effective manner.
